The correct answer, which encompasses the concept of 'land,' includes both the physical ground and the air space above it. In real estate and land use terminology, 'land' is defined in a broader context that goes beyond just the surface of the earth. This means that 'land' is not limited to the soil and terrain itself; it also includes the vertical space above the surface, up to the atmosphere, as well as any resources found beneath the ground, such as minerals and water.

Understanding this definition is crucial because it impacts various aspects of property rights, land use regulations, and real estate transactions. For instance, air rights are a significant consideration in urban areas, where the space above a property may have value and can be sold or leased separately from the ground itself.

This comprehensive understanding of 'land' is essential for those studying real estate and can influence decisions related to zoning, development, and environmental impact assessments.
